Output fca5222ec00bc4e926ce483b7be4b901d49acbd913b0f2c9d04db2777fa3d367:0

value
344000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8674bfa91c899f445c5bde695c4a069013890102 OP_EQUAL
address
3DwxL684YpbfQ3ApPq4G16XQANKZyqDNcF
transaction
fca5222ec00bc4e926ce483b7be4b901d49acbd913b0f2c9d04db2777fa3d367
confirmations
258454
spent
true